Job Description

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Oversee all daily housekeeping, laundry, and public area operations for the hotel
  • Ensure all guest rooms, public areas, laundry facilities, heart of house areas, storage rooms, and exterior housekeeping spaces are consistently maintained to Hilton and Shaner standards
  • Ensure compliance with and completion of all daily operational procedures within the Housekeeping Department
  • Maintain complete knowledge of and comply with all Shaner Hotels, Hilton, and departmental policies and procedures while ensuring the housekeeping team is informed and compliant as well
  • Lead, motivate, coach, train, and develop housekeeping team members while maintaining a positive and productive work environment
  • Hire, onboard, and train new associates while ensuring all required company and brand training is completed timely and accurately
  • Conduct daily room inspections and cleanliness walkthroughs to ensure quality standards are consistently achieved
  • Handle guest complaints professionally and efficiently while ensuring proper service recovery and guest satisfaction
  • Review daily occupancy levels, arrivals, departures, group business, stayovers, and special requests to proactively plan staffing and operational needs
  • Prepare weekly schedules based on occupancy forecasts, labor expectations, productivity goals, and business demand
  • Adjust schedules throughout the week as business levels fluctuate while maintaining productivity and service standards
  • Manage employee performance including coaching, counseling, recognition, disciplinary action, and accountability conversations when necessary
  • Ensure room attendants, laundry attendants, and housepersons are meeting productivity and cleanliness expectations daily
  • Monitor housekeeping labor closely and assist in managing departmental payroll and annual budget expectations
  • Maintain the Housekeeping Department annual budget and assist in controlling departmental expenses
  • Ensure all inventories, ordering, and housekeeping supply levels are maintained appropriately
  • Monitor and maintain cleanliness, sanitation, safety, and organization of all assigned areas
  • Maintain knowledge of all cleaning procedures, sanitation standards, chemical handling requirements, and equipment usage
  • Ensure all safety procedures are followed properly by the housekeeping team
  • Complete all required monthly reporting, inventories, inspections, and departmental documentation accurately and on time
  • Assist team members with housekeeping, laundry, and houseperson duties whenever operationally necessary
  • Partner closely with Front Office, Maintenance, and Hotel Leadership to ensure overall hotel operational success
  • Be available to work a flexible schedule including weekends, holidays, varied shifts, and high demand event periods
  • Perform all other duties as assigned

About Shaner Hotels

Headquartered in State College, Pa., Shaner Hotels is part of the Shaner Companies, a diversified, privately held company that owns and operates investments in the lodging, investment, energy and professional service sectors. Shaner Hotels is a developer/owner/operator that currently owns and manages 60+ hotels in the United States, Italy, Greece and the Bahamas under the Marriott, IHG, Hilton and Choice brands as well as some independent properties.
